I have rung up AAMI due to their insurance package which for an extra $125 I can get fire and theft up to $5000.


Because I have dropped a 308 motor in a car that came with a 253 they don't want to know about me.


Which companies out there will allow me to have third party property damage?


Any with similar deals to AAMI for fire and theft would also be helpful.
